A southwestern Jhalokati upazila on the tidal Bishkhali river, agrarian and trade-based with a low, green, flood-prone landscape.

Problems and issues

  1. climate disaster A low-lying tidal-river tract prone to monsoon flooding, tidal surge and waterlogging of its dense canal-and-orchard network. So what: Recurrent flooding and surge damage crops, homes and trade. Source: Department of Disaster Management
  2. water Communities depend on tidal channels with little permanent surface water, exposed to siltation and downstream salinity creep. So what: Tidal salinity and contamination threaten safe drinking water. Source: Department of Public Health Engineering
  3. poverty Mean Relative Wealth Index is -0.085 (national rank 220 of 452, fifth decile), below the national mean in an agrarian river-trade economy. So what: Modest incomes limit recovery capacity after flood losses. Source: Meta Data for Good Relative Wealth Index (HDX)
